Bill Text: NY A02188 | 2019-2020 | General Assembly | Amended


Bill Title: Requires the display of a bus driver's credentials prominently while he or she is on duty and changes the review of his or her files by the department from every three years to annually.

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 1-0)

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2020-01-08 - referred to transportation [A02188 Detail]

        AN ACT to amend the vehicle and traffic law, in relation to the display-
          ing of a bus driver's credentials while he or she is on duty  and  the
          review of his or her files

          The  People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em-
        bly, do enact as follows:

     1    Section 1. The vehicle and traffic law is  amended  by  adding  a  new
     2  section 509-dd to read as follows:
     3    §  509-dd.  Passenger  motor  carrier information. The commissioner of
     4  transportation, in consultation with the commissioner,  shall  establish
     5  requirements  for  motor carriers required to obtain approval to operate
     6  as a common or contract carrier of passengers by motor vehicle from  the
     7  commissioner  of transportation for purposes of establishing conspicuous
     8  display of valid operating authority, inspection information, and driver
     9  qualifications at locations  where  such  persons  or  entities  perform
    10  contract  or common carrier services with such motor vehicles and within
    11  any motor vehicle used to provide such services.  For  the  purposes  of
    12  this  section,  "motor  carriers"  shall not include buses referenced in
    13  paragraph (a) or (e) of subdivision one of section five  hundred  nine-a
    14  of this article.
    15    § 2. Subdivision 1 of section 509-m of the vehicle and traffic law, as
    16  added  by chapter 675 of the laws of 1985, is amended and a new subdivi-
    17  sion 8 is added to read as follows:
    18    1. At least once [every three years] annually, review the  bus  driver
    19  files  of  each  motor carrier, provided, however, that the commissioner
    20  may review such bus driver files at his discretion  at  any  other  time
    21  during regular business hours.

     1    8.  Issue  new  credentials,  designed for public display, which shall
     2  serve as proof that a  bus  driver  is  qualified  under  sections  five
     3  hundred  nine-b  and  five hundred nine-dd of this article. Such creden-
     4  tials shall be re-issued annually.
     5    §  3. This act shall take effect on the first of April next succeeding
     6  the date on which it shall have become a law. Effective immediately, the
     7  addition, amendment and/or repeal of any rule  or  regulation  necessary
     8  for  the implementation of this act on its effective date are authorized
     9  to be made and completed on or before such effective date.
